The Contraband Shore
Book 1 in the Contraband Shore series.

In 1787, Edward Brazier arrives in Deal intending to marry the widowed Betsey Langridge. Her brother Henry Tulkington blocks the match, while the former naval captain quickly discovers that the town’s merchants and officials are bound to a powerful smuggling organisation.
Brazier’s courtship becomes an investigation into violence, corruption and an old injustice connected with Betsey’s family. Marked as a threat by the local gang, he must decide how far he will go to challenge men whose influence reaches well beyond the shoreline.
